Output 31e389fa4ee4a1bdae5d205b2fe4b550ab76c3b0eb1bf1f8c167bdab945c0969:5

value
584871902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c7e34d9c080a7c01a26b56f9138c6ed5f6cf510 OP_EQUAL
address
3Qi5PrzUvVAMcFw9aMLCyXnLjyH5Zy7W57
transaction
31e389fa4ee4a1bdae5d205b2fe4b550ab76c3b0eb1bf1f8c167bdab945c0969
spent
true